Industrial submersible pH / ORP meters can be used in open waterways or tanks. According to the conditions of use, choose a suitable combination of submerged sheath and electrode. The electrodes introduced in this article are all KCl replenishment electrodes. For flow-through installation, please refer to the relevant specifications of the flow-through pH / ORP meter detector.
● KCl replenishment electrode immersion detector
The submerged pH • ORP detector used in combination with the KCl replenishment electrode contains a large amount of KCl reference solution. It can be used in various measurement conditions ranging from wastewater treatment processes to harsh industrial processes, and is widely used. And there are a variety of liquid connection materials and different types of electrodes to choose from. In addition, in order to maintain a long-term stable reference point and ensure a highly reliable measurement, there are various pressure immersion detectors to choose from.

● General specifications
Construction: Rainproof construction (JIS C 0920)
Internal liquid volume: about 500mL (when the sheath length is 1.0m)
Water sample conditions: pressure ... atmospheric pressure (no pressure), Max 0.15MPa (pressurized type), flow rate ... 2m / s or less
● Model classification
No pressure | Pressurized | Features | |
Drainage neutralization control monitoring | HC-763 | HC-753 | • The translucent PP (polypropylene) sheath is used, which has heat resistance and chemical resistance. |
• The length of the sheath increases in steps of 0.5m, up to 3m. | |||
• For general use, it should be installed to avoid direct sunlight. | |||
HC-703C | HC-753C | • Adopt transparent PVC (polyvinyl chloride) material sheath, high strength and not easy to bend. | |
• The length of the sheath increases in steps of 0.5m, up to 4m. | |||
For online process control | HC-703F | HC-753T | • A translucent, PVDF (polyvinylidene fluoride) sheath is used, which is good. |
Drug resistance, high temperature resistance, etc.。 | |||
• Good weather resistance, direct sunlight. | |||
• The length of the mounting rod is increased in steps of 0.5m, up to 4m. | |||
HC-703T | HC-753T | • Adopt fluororesin material (translucent PFA) mounting rod resistant to organic solvents. Sealing and filling | |
Use perfluoroelastomer resistant to organic solvents. | |||
• The length of the mounting rod is increased in steps of 0.5m, up to 3m. | |||
Note) Recommended conditions for pressurized installation: ① Installed in a sealed tank with internal pressure. ②The occasion where the water sample is more polluted and the salt bridge is easy to scale. ③ When measuring low ion water (conductivity is less than 200μS / cm). |
